Responsibilities

What You’ll Do

As a Sous Chef at Big Sky Resort, you will:

  • Partner with the Executive Chef to lead and develop a high-performing culinary team while cultivating a fun, professional, and supportive kitchen culture.
  • Execute all menu items with consistency, ensuring every plate meets our standards for flavor, texture, and presentation.
  • Manage daily operations including inventory, ordering, and food cost controls.
  • Jump onto any station as needed to support the team and keep service seamless.
  • Lead daily line-ups and communicate expectations clearly and constructively.
  • Enforce top-tier cleanliness, sanitation, and safety standards.
  • Participate in leadership meetings, cross-department initiatives, and training opportunities to strengthen your professional skill set.
  • Coach, mentor, and develop your team—helping emerging cooks become future sous chefs.
  • Uphold Boyne Standards and Boyne Basics to ensure an exceptional and consistent guest experience.

Qualifications

  • Minimum 2 years of culinary leadership experience in a professional kitchen.
  • Mastery of multiple cooking techniques and advanced knife skills.
  • Strong understanding of HACCP, food safety, and operational best practices.
  • Proven ability to lead, train, and inspire others.
  • High attention to detail and personal accountability.
  • Positive communicator who builds trust and respect within a team.
  • Flexibility to work early, mid, or late shifts—including weekends and holidays.
  • Physical ability to lift at least 35 lbs, stand for extended periods, climb stairs, and carry trays.
